Sophie Willan: A Remarkable Voice in Stand-Up Comedy

On September 12, 2025

Introduction

Sophie Willan, a British comedian, writer, and actress, has emerged as a significant figure in the UK comedy scene. Her unique blend of humour, storytelling, and poignant social commentary has garnered her a dedicated following. As the entertainment landscape evolves, Willan’s ability to connect with audiences through her personal experiences becomes increasingly relevant, especially in addressing themes of identity, mental health, and resilience.

Recent Achievements and Performances

In recent months, Willan has been making headlines for her outstanding performances in various comedy festivals across the UK. She has been featured in the Edinburgh Festival Fringe, where her show “Sophie Willan: On the Edge” received rave reviews from critics and audiences alike. Critics praised her for her ability to blend personal anecdotes with broader social issues, making her comedy both relatable and impactful.

Moreover, Willan’s work extends beyond stand-up. She is the creator of the BBC series “Alma’s Not Normal,” which has been well-received for its authentic portrayal of mental health issues and its witty narrative style. The show has contributed to conversations surrounding serious topics while maintaining a humorous tone, a balance that Willan has mastered.

Recognition and Influence

Willan’s influence has not gone unnoticed. She was awarded the ‘Best Breakthrough Act’ at the 2022 British Comedy Awards, solidifying her status as a rising star. The recognition reflects not only her talent but also the significance of her narrative, which resonates with a diverse audience. By sharing her personal journey, including her experiences growing up in the care system, Willan has carved a niche that invites empathy and understanding while providing entertainment.
